
python如何建立表
用户关注问题
Python中有哪些库可以用来创建数据库表?
我想用Python来创建数据库表,请问有哪些常用的库可以帮助实现这一功能?
常用的Python数据库库介绍
Python中常用的数据库操作库包括sqlite3、SQLAlchemy和Psycopg2等。sqlite3适合轻量级数据库操作,内置于Python标准库,适合快速建立和管理SQLite数据库表。SQLAlchemy则是一个强大的ORM框架,可以方便地通过Python代码创建和管理多种类型的数据库表。Psycopg2则更适合用来操作PostgreSQL数据库。根据你的需求选择合适的库,可以更高效地建立数据库表。
用Python创建表时需要准备哪些基础知识?
我刚开始学习Python建立数据库表,应该掌握哪些基础知识才能顺利完成?
建立数据库表的基础知识建议
在使用Python创建数据库表之前,了解关系型数据库的基本概念非常重要,包括数据库、表、字段、数据类型以及主键等。熟悉SQL语言中的CREATE TABLE语句也能帮助理解表的结构定义。此外,掌握你所使用的Python数据库库的基本用法和API,能够让你更得心应手地完成表的创建工作。
Python建立数据库表时如何保证数据结构合理?
我担心建立的表结构不合理导致后期维护困难,请问在使用Python创建表时应注意什么?
确保数据库表结构合理的建议
设计数据库表结构时,应该先明确表所需存储的数据类型和业务逻辑,合理规划字段和数据类型,避免冗余数据。可以通过定义主键确保数据的唯一性,并利用外键维护数据关联一致性。使用Python的ORM如SQLAlchemy还能让你在代码层面更灵活地控制表结构设计。编写合适的注释和文档,方便团队协作和后续维护。